Default FS: 2006 Z06 (2LZ, low miles, nav, like new, warranty)

I am selling my 2006 Corvette Z06 2LZ option package with navigation and OEM compition grey wheels. Exterior color is machine silver, interior color is black leather. The Z06 just turned 11,000 miles and looks and smells new. Not a single defect on the car! Always garaged and detailed, maintained by myself, covered under a 5 yr 75K mile transferrable warranty. The car is all original never modified, raced, or abused and it only comes out on nice summer days. I have all original documenation including the window sticker. If your looking for a like new Z06 this is the one. Only modification is 35% Llumar window tint and the addition of a 2010 4LT center console bezel as seen below (original is included).
Also, for those interested this is a late built 06. All body panels are 100% original as is the paint. Never any work done to this car whatsoever.

NOTE: I have had a lot of questions regarding the warranty. I purchased the warranty only 4 months ago so its basically brand new. I have the transfer form in hand it only costs $50.00 to transfer it. I paid just under $2,000 for this warranty.
